Output e075d4ab229fa5eb163b9821b494f6c5179a5032214ec32e05b9e930255730d0:12

value
36871710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bcdcb8ee0bf663a61d3c25d3311b910c9864a74 OP_EQUAL
address
3MjESTBabd8otNQ8KEBG6YKZ55k6RfW5qU
transaction
e075d4ab229fa5eb163b9821b494f6c5179a5032214ec32e05b9e930255730d0
spent
true